Description

In this unit pupils investigate food and drinks providing energy and nutrients for our health. They explore some of the functions of nutrients, as well as food sources. Main nutrients are linked to the Eatwell Guide food groups.

Food and drinks provide the energy and nutrients required by the body to grow, be active and maintain health. Being able to describe different nutrients, and their sources and function, gives an appreciation for the need and importance of a varied and balanced diet for good nutrition. This learning extends the Healthy eating and nutrition thread from Year 4, showing how the Eatwell Guide conveys nutrition messaging via food groups. In Year 6, pupils use and apply Healthy eating and nutrition messages to their own and others' diets.
